# HiveServer与NGINX负载均衡的实现
在现代的应用程序架构中,负载均衡是保障系统高可用性与可扩展性的关键技术之一。HiveServer是Apache Hive的服务端组件,而NGINX是一个广泛使用的高性能HTTP和反向代理服务器。将这两者结合使用,可以有效地提升数据查询的效率和稳定性。本文将介绍如何使用NGINX对HiveServer进行负载均衡,并通过代码示例说明具体实现过程。
## 实现 Redis 和 Nginx 负载均衡的流程与步骤
在这篇文章中,我们将会学习如何配置 Redis 和 Nginx,以实现负载均衡。整个流程可以分为几个步骤,如下表所示:
| 步骤 | 描述 |
|------|------|
| 1 | 安装Redis,配置主从机制供负载均衡使用 |
| 2 | 安装Nginx,配置反向代理以实现负载均衡 |
| 3 | 创建初步
gRPC服务发现&负载均衡gRPC 是一个高性能、开源、通用的 RPC 框架,面向移动和 HTTP/2 设计,是由谷歌发布的首款基于 Protocol Buffers 的 RPC 框架。 gRPC 基于 HTTP/2 标准设计,带来诸如双向流、流控、头部压缩、单 TCP 连接上的多复用请求等特性。构建高可用、高性能的通信服务,通常采用服务注册与发现、负载均衡和容错处理等机制实现。根据负载均
一 反向代理和负载均衡小结① 反向代理'反向'代理'角色':'转发'客户端的'请求(request)'和'服务端'的'响应(response)'
1)client将'请求'发送至proxy服务器
2)proxy服务器'再将请求'转发给'真正的服务器(server)'以处理请求
3)响应时'server'将处理结果发送给'proxy',再由'proxy'响应给客户端
集群技术概述: LB(负载均衡集群):LVS、Haproxy、Nginx、F5 BigIP HA(高可用集群):keepalived、RFCS、Pacemaker、Heartbeat HP(高性能集群):Hadoop,sparkKeepalived介绍: keepalived 是linux下一个轻量级的高可用解决方案。其与Heartbeat等实现的功能类似,
转载
2023-10-14 09:36:24
85阅读
Nginx 反向代理 负载均衡 虚拟主机配置通过本章你将学会利用Nginx配置多台虚拟主机,清楚代理服务器的作用,区分正向代理和反向代理的区别,搭建使用Nginx反向搭理和负载均衡,了解Nginx常用配置的说明。即学即用,你还在等什么?一睹为快先了解Nginx的三大功能 Nginx 可以作为一台http服务器。可以做网站静态服务器,比如图片服务器,高效,减轻服务器压力。同时它也支持https服务。
在Kubernetes中实现负载均衡可以通过使用Nginx作为Ingress Controller来实现。下面我将向你介绍如何在Kubernetes集群中实现k8s负载均衡ngix。
步骤如下:
| 步骤 | 操作 |
|--------|--------|
| 1 | 安装Nginx Ingress Controller |
| 2 | 配置Ingress 资源 |
| 3 | 部署服务并启
Nginx+tomcat负载均衡 实验环境: 192.168.10.5 nginx &n
原创
2016-10-09 10:59:27
689阅读
#一、Nginx+Tomcat负载均衡、动静分离 Nginx 服务器:192.168.80.13:80 Tomcat服务器1:192.168.80.14:8080 Tomcat服务器2(多实例):192.168.80.12:8080 192.168.80.12:8081 ##1.1、部署Nginx负 ...
转载
2021-08-19 16:01:00
151阅读
2评论
轮询访问 一台服务配置好了,接着把三个tomcat服务全部放到一块,让访问http://192.168.64.129/能自动分配到8081、8082、8083这三个服务器上,实现负载均衡 vim打开/usr/local/nginx/conf/nginx.conf 在server上方加个upstrea ...
转载
2021-07-24 14:38:00
148阅读
2评论
源码安装tengine-2.1.0单节点、实现tomcat负载均衡 一、环境准备服务器:192.168.1.101 tomcat7、tengine192.168.1.102 tomcat7 1、下载tengine-2.1.0.tar.gz---->http://tengine.taobao.org/download_cn.h
原创
2022-11-03 14:55:40
327阅读
现在我们要做个简单的基于servlet的MVC的模型,我们要有一个Product要从表单处获取。MVC中的M是模型,V是视图,C是控制器。视图负责应用的展示,模型封装了数据和业务逻辑,控制器负责接收用户输入,改变模型以及调整视图是显示。在现代框架中,servlet和filter都可以作为controller,也就是控制器。MVC中的业务逻辑一般叫做action,每个HTTP请求发给控制器,请求中的
集群就是在多个应用服务(如:Tomcat)前端设一个前端控制器,负责请求的接收和转发,多数是起到一个分流的作用,把压力分散到每一个应用服务上。 负载均衡就是在集群的基础上前端控制器尽量可以做到对每一个应用服务的请求平衡,负载均衡,即尽量把压力平均分配到每一个后端应用服务,从而达到整个系统的高性能和高可用性。 Apache通常是作为应用服务器的集群的前端。而集群并不局
一、web server sessionserver端session:1、service向用户浏览器发送cookie,此cookie包含获取服务端session的标识。2、向用户通过浏览器请求同一站点的页面时,相应的cookie信息会随之发送。3、server从cookie信息中识别出与此浏览器相关的session标识,从而判别出当前server上此浏览器的session信息。在用户浏览器不支持c
原创
2017-01-17 15:59:52
2152阅读
不容易啊,给国足一个大大的赞!!!----------------------------------------------------------------------------------------------------------------------我是华丽的分隔符前言:tomcat软件是由sun公司软件架构师詹姆斯.邓肯.戴维森开发,logo是一只公猫,大家应该看过经典动画片
原创
2017-03-24 00:04:51
1127阅读
点赞
Tomcat及其负载均衡一、实验环境二、实验步骤1、部署Tomcat 11)启动后关闭防火墙#service iptables stop2)安装JDK,配置Java环境#tar xf jdk-7u65-linux-x64.gz#mv jdk1.7.0_65/ /usr/local
原创
2017-08-09 01:12:26
533阅读
一、理论部分Tomcat介绍Tomcat是Apache 软件基金会(Apache Software Foundation)的Jakarta 项目中的一个核心项目,由Apache、Sun 和其他一些公司及个人共同开发而成。由于有了Sun 的参与和支持,最新的Servlet 和.4 和JSP 2.0 规范...
原创
2021-11-19 14:54:11
200阅读
port值。<Server p
原创
2023-06-28 14:05:39
165阅读
Tomcat及其负载均衡一、实验环境二、实验步骤1、部署Tomcat 11)启动后关闭防火墙#service iptables stop2)安装JDK,配置Java环境#tar xf jdk-7u65-linux-x64.gz#mv jdk1.7.0_65/ /usr/local
转载
2017-09-09 12:11:29
576阅读
Web应用服务器的选择*(1)IBM的WebSphere及Oracle的WebLogic性能高,但价格也高*(2)Tomcat性价比高Tomcat服务器是一个免费的开放源代码的Web应用服务器,属于轻量级应用服务器,在中小型系统和并发访问用户不是很多的场合下被普遍使用,是开发和调试JSP程序的首选。一般来说,Tomcat虽然和Apache或者Nginx这些Web服务器一样,具有处理HTML页面的功
原创
2018-10-09 17:25:42
508阅读
点赞